迅睿CMS开启https访问后,前端无法展示处理方法

      发布在:后端技术      评论:0 条评论

迅睿CMS开启https访问后,前端无法展示,来回多次重定向

image

经分析,用的是西部数据的IIS虚拟机,根本就没办法获取https相关环境变量,所以通过后台开启的协议与环境变量获取的协议不相符,所以就不断的来回跳转,解决方法就是找到\dayrui\Fcms\Init.php大概在226行(!IS_ADMIN && isset($system['SYS_HTTPS']) && $system['SYS_HTTPS'])修改成(defined('SYS_HTTPS') && SYS_HTTPS)这应该是官方的一个bug吧,因为$system变量在97行就已经注销了,所以这里一直就是不成立的

相关文章
热门推荐